2021 RWF to SAR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2021

During 2021, the RWF to SAR ex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 8, valuing the pair at 0.0038.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 18, dropping to 0.0036.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0003 SAR.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0038 to the December average rate of 0.0037, the exchange rate registered a net change of -3.33%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2021 high of 0.0038 was down 4.57% compared to the 2020 peak of 0.0040,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
